563 yards last year with Mariota throwing him the ball. He could be productive with Brady. If he comes in for cheap, I’d be curious to see what he has left. If he’s truly cooked, cut him.

Good post "K".
But Decker is actually younger than JE and Hogan. I think Mitchell is what he is unfortunately, glass knees. He will never play 16.
Matthews plays the slot and he intrigues me.
Dorsett should play the slot, but he is in the Cook role (Not a Red Zone guy).
Britt is an unknown (not a Red Zone guy even with his size).
Patterson might surprise but (not a Red Zone guy).

So the guy day 1 for the Pats (no JE) with the most 2017 production could be Decker. His Red Zone prowess might be the best of any other than Gronk.

The Pats always have had trouble covering Decker. I am sure BB remembers.

Teams paid more attention to Hogan last year and he did not get as open. He kind of flat lined.

JE is in his contract year and out for 4. Hogan is in his last contract year. Dorsett is in his last year. Britt is as well. Matthews is here on a prove it/one year contract.

So in 2019 your WR corps could be Mitchell and Patterson. 5 WR can walk.

So Decker for two makes sense.
